Personal Injury
Personal injury cases make up the majority of civil lawsuits. They include every type of accident which could cause an individual to sustain physical injuries. This includes workplace accidents, car accidents incidents and assault claims. Additionally a personal injury claim may include an event that causes the death of another person (wrongful death).
A successful personal injury case could result in compensation for current and future medical expenses. This might also include a payment to compensate for lost wages and other financial losses. In addition, an injured victim can seek damages that are not economic for suffering and pain and loss of enjoyment of life.

Car Accidents
Car accidents are one of the most prevalent types of personal injuries. They can occur for many reasons, including human error and environmental factors. Even with the most modern technology, such as adaptive headlights and backup cameras accidents still happen in cars with serious injuries. It is essential to remain at the scene of the accident if you're injured. You can call the police if needed. It's a crime to leave the scene of an accident that has caused significant injury or damage to property. Once law enforcement personnel arrive, they'll write an accident report that outlines the person they believe to be at fault and any citations that they might issue.

Wrongful Death
The family of a victim's loved ones who has suffered a fatal accident may be entitled to compensation. In a wrongful-death case, the person who caused the accident is held accountable. This differs from murder in that in a claim for wrongful death it is not enough to prove that the perpetrator was intent to cause harm to another person; they must have had the duty of care and violated this duty, resulting into injuries that resulted in the victim's death.
Wrongful Death cases are often complex to determine a defendant's duty to care to calculating the value of a loved ones. A seasoned lawyer who has experience in accident and injury can assist clients in navigating these issues.

A wrongful death lawsuit could result in various types of damages, including punitive damages. They are designed to punish the perpetrator, and discourage others from committing similar negligent acts. Damages could include funeral expenses, loss companionship and other financial losses directly related to the death of loved ones.

Medical Malpractice
Medical malpractice can cause serious injuries or even death. When dealing with a medical malpractice matter, it is important to have an attorney to defend your rights.
A medical malpractice lawsuit is a civil suit which claims negligence on behalf of a health professional. It can be filed against a doctor, dentist or health care provider if they fail to provide standard care required by their profession and cause injury or death to patients. Malpractice claims are founded on tort law. This grew out of English common law and was developed through court decisions and legislative statues that vary by state.
Medical malpractice victims are entitled to compensation for their past and future expenses relating to the incident. In addition to covering medical expenses, these expenses could include lost wages if you were unable to work due to the injury, as well as suffering and pain. Certain states have set limits on the amount that may be awarded in malpractice cases. These caps are typically placed on non-economic damages, which are are more difficult to quantify and comprise things like pain and suffering, disfigurement, loss of companionship, and mental or emotional suffering. New York does not have limits on damages which means that you can receive the entire amount of your losses.
